Dr. Miguel A Perez-Pinzon's lab at the University of Miami focuses on understanding how ischemic preconditioning can protect the brain from stroke-related damage. They study the role of specific molecules like Brain-Derived Neurotrophic Factor (BDNF) and Resveratrol in improving brain function and synaptic health. The lab aims to uncover new therapeutic strategies to help patients recover cognitive function after a stroke and potentially benefit those with related conditions like Alzheimer's disease.
